Before you start
- Isolate all supplies at the breaker and verify dead before opening anything.
- Electrical work must be done by a person qualified under your local rules.
- This is automation, not a safety system — it does not replace a barrier, an alarm, or supervision.

Wire the relay driver board
Field wiring lands on the relay driver board: eight SPDT relays for high-voltage loads, four RS-485 ports for equipment that speaks it, four valve-actuator outputs, and two auxiliary channels.
The map is drawn to scale from the board's pick-and-place file, so the positions match the physical board.

Power and commissioning
The board takes 24 V AC and 24 V DC on separate terminals, with a fuse on the input. Bring power up before pairing so the module can be reached from the app.

Terminal reference
Read from the relay driver board’s own BOM and pick-and-place files, so the designators match the silkscreen.
| Designator | Qty | What it is | Notes |
|---|---|---|---|
| K9–K16 | 8 | SPDT relay outputs | Omron G5LE-14-DC5 · N.C / COM / N.O per channel |
| RS485_1–4 | 4 | RS-485 ports | G / B / A per port |
| VALV1–4 | 4 | Valve actuator outputs | JST B3B-XH-A 3-pin |
| PORTA1–PORTD1 | 4 | Expansion ports | G / B / A per port |
| AUX1, AUX2 | 2 | Auxiliary channels | TODO — confirm intended use |
| H1, H2 | 2 | Header connectors | TODO — confirm function |
| 24VAC1 | 1 | 24 V AC input | CUI TB002-500-02BE terminal block |
| 24VDC1 | 1 | 24 V DC input | CUI TB002-500-02BE terminal block |
| I2C1 | 1 | I²C expansion | JST B3B-XH-A |
| F1 | 1 | Input fuse | 0686F1000-01 |
| U-series | 3 | I/O expander & regulator | MCP23017 I/O expander · LM2575HV switcher |
